It's review preview day over on the ATS blog and I've got a second take on April's adorable addition to the Swiss Pixies... Rainy Day Birgitta. I really couldn't wait to give Birgitta a lighter and brighter look this go round. :)

I know that I already used some of these Chloe's Closet papers yesterday but considering that great blue in them I thought it would be a nice choice for this stamp as well. But I didn't want it to be as heavy in the blues as my last Rainy Day Birgitta card so that's where the bit of orange and yellow really cheer this one up. I picture this version of her to be at the end of the storm with the sky finally clearing and the sunshine peeking out from behind the clouds. I still added a bit of a green cast to her hair and body with the YG00 but it is a much more subtle look compared to Birgitta with the E80s hair. I also altered her just a bit by drawing in a couple lines to give her dress a separate bodice and sleeves so that I could give her outfit more color too.

Supply list:
cardstock- Bazzill and Copic X-Press It
paper- Making Memories (Chloe's Closet)
stamps- CC Designs (Swiss Pixie Rainy Day Birgitta), Amy R (So Wordy sentiment)
ink- Memento tuxedo black and rich cocoa, Colorbox chestnut roan
The Twinery twine
Prima flowers
Kaiser Craft pearls
Martha Stewart butterfly punch
Zva pearls
Copic markers:
skin- E000, E00, E11, R00, R20
hair- E50, E51, Y32, Y35, E33, YG00
clothes- B32, B34, B37, E40, E41, 0, YR12, YR14, YR18, YG01, YG03, YG17
